In addition to Phoenix, Robert also lived in Peoria, Fontana, Scottsdale and 9 other cities. 1052 Monte Cristo Ave, Phoenix, Az 85022 is where Robert resides. The current age of Robert is 58. 1966 is his birth date. Records link phone number (909) 466-9534 with Robert’s details. Company linked with Robert is: Tyers Contracting, Inc. We have found 9 possible relatives of Robert: Robert Lee Luis, Teresa A Johnson, Theresa G Kennedy and 6 other people.